The SMCG48A-E3/57T diode has a standard SMC package with two pins. The pinout configuration is as follows: 1. Anode (+) 2. Cathode (-)
The SMCG48A-E3/57T operates based on the principle of rectification, allowing current flow in one direction while blocking it in the opposite direction. When forward-biased, it conducts current with minimal voltage drop, making it suitable for various electronic applications.
The SMCG48A-E3/57T diode finds extensive use in the following applications: - Voltage clamping - Reverse polarity protection - Overvoltage protection in power supplies - Snubber circuits in power electronics
Some alternative models to the SMCG48A-E3/57T diode include: - 1.5KE48CA - P4SMA48CA - SMBJ48CA
